On 13/01/2023 12.16, Eyal Lebedinsky wrote:
I am on f36, was running kernel 6.0.15 and did a 'dnf update' which installed 6.0.18.

On boot I had no HDMI sound, only line-out (which was plugged in) had sound.

Looking at the logs (grep 'sound') I see in 6.0.15

You will notice the missing last two HDMI devices.

Looking at PulseAudio I see that the one HDMI that I usually use:
     Digital Stereo (HDMI3) Output + Analog Stereo Input
is now unavailable:
     Digital Stereo (HDMI3) Output + Analog Stereo Input (unavailable)

I rebooted again into 6.0.18 with no sound again. Booted 6.0.15 and sound is back.

Is there a simple way to get HDMI sound back with 6.0.18? I hate running a kernel older than the rest of the distro.
What other info will help?

[later]
I removed a huge number of debuginfo/debugsource packages (leftover from debugging a mythtv crash). This should have no effect.
Rebooted to 6.0.18.

I now still see a shorter list of HDMI devices, but two of them are available and provide HDMI sound
	Digital Stereo (HDMI) Output
	Digital Stereo (HDMI) Output + Analog Stereo Input
These were also available on the first boots to 6.0.18 but without sound.

HDMI4 and HDMI5 are now missing and HDMI3 (which I always used) is marked (unavailable).
I am convinced that I tested all earlier with no HDMI sound, clearly something changed from 6.0.15 to 6.0.18.
